What is the cheapest month to fly from Bordeaux to London?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Bordeaux to London,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Bordeaux to London is March, where tickets cost £70 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are August and July,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is £130 and £121 respectively.

  • How do I get from London Heathrow Airport (LHR) to the city centre?

    If you're looking for an affordable option, the London Underground can take you from Heathrow to the city centre in around 45 minutes. The cost will depend on how many zones you pass through, but expect to pay around £6-£7. For a quicker and more direct route, the Heathrow Express is worth considering. This train will get you to Paddington Station in just 15 minutes and costs around £22 each way. Ride-sharing apps like Uber and Lyft are also readily available at Heathrow.

  • What is the luggage allowance on Vueling flights from Bordeaux to London?

    Vueling Airlines allows each passenger to bring one carry-on bag and one personal item on board flights from Bordeaux to London, free of charge. The carry-on bag must not exceed the dimensions of 55 cm x 40 cm x 20 cm and the personal item should fit under the seat in front of the passenger with a maximum size of 35 cm x 20 cm x 20 cm.

  • Bordeaux-Merignac Airport (BOD) has three terminals: Hall A, Hall B, and the Billi Terminal. Terminal A is mainly for international flights like flights from Bordeaux to London, while Terminal B is principally dedicated to Air France and its partners. The Billi Terminal is reserved for low-cost carriers such as easyJet.
